450 km at 320 km/h: the Kenitra-Marrakech TGV project is taking shape



The National Office of Railways (ONCF) is working hard to complete the construction project of the High Speed ​​Line (HSL) between Kenitra and Marrakech. It recently launched a call for tenders for the selection of an external quality control laboratory for civil engineering works and buildings.


ONCF is looking for a control office that will be responsible for carrying out external quality control services for all civil engineering works, awarded to the various companies for the construction of the two-track railway platform as well as the buildings between Kenitra and Marrakech. In this sense, it has launched a call for tenders.
